Ingredients
Scale
- 2 teaspoons coconut rum extract
- 1 cup sweetened condensed milk
- 1/2 cup melted butter
- 2 cups shredded coconut
- 1 1/2 cups powdered sugar
- Vanilla extract
Instructions
- Prepare Your Pan: Start by greasing an 8×8 inch baking dish or lining it with parchment paper. This will make it easy to remove the squares later.
- Mix Wet Ingredients: In a medium bowl, combine 1 cup of sweetened condensed milk, 1/2 cup of melted butter, and 2 teaspoons of coconut rum extract (or your non-alcoholic alternative). Whisk until smooth.
- Add Dry Ingredients: Gradually stir in 2 cups of shredded coconut and 1 1/2 cups of powdered sugar. Mix until everything is well combined and the mixture becomes a thick batter.
- Spread in Pan: Pour the mixture into the prepared baking dish, spreading it evenly with a spatula. Press it down gently to compact the mixture.
- Chill: Cover the dish with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 2 hours, or until the mixture is firm enough to cut into squares.
- Cut into Squares: Once chilled, lift the mixture out of the pan using the parchment paper, if used. Cut into small squares or bars, depending on your preference.
- Dust with Coconut: For an extra touch, you can roll the squares in additional shredded coconut to coat them before serving.
